Scenery
Resting along the rugged coastline of the Fleurieu Peninsula, the hilltop views of McLaren Vale South extend over the valley and right to sea. Verdant, rolling vines fill the landscape as you travel to wineries which offer spectacular vistas and even better wines.
Wine
Continuing to blend old and new, McLaren Vale South is renowned as much for its traditional wines as it is for its newer styles. With newer styles like Sangiovese and Barbera nestled amongst the more traditional Shiraz, Grenache, and Cabernet Sauvignon, there is sure to be something for everyone in the beautiful McLaren Vale South.
Food
McLaren Vale South boasts a variety of fine and varied food options to satisfy every taste and budget. You can find gorgeous and tasty platters of local produce or fine dining or make a stop at any one of the many bakeries or cafes in the McLaren Vale Township. You can even pack a picnic and sit on the hilltop at Kay Brothers and soak in the serenity.
